If the majority of people working on AI are from one ethnic background then the AI they create will be skewed by there bias, be it conscious or unconscious.

I wouldn't have thought that would be much of a suprise?

It is easy to ridicule this if you don't understand AI

Microsoft launched Tay, a robot to chat and learn on Twitter. Within 16 hours it had gone from 'humans are cool' to comments about Hitler being right and hating feminists and wishing they would burn. Admittedly this seems to be because it was deliberately targeted by trolls but it shows just how quickly AI can pick up our biases.

Amazon tried to get AI to sift job applicants - it was given CV's and the subsequent jobs of Amazon staff as well as those who failed in their applications to learn from. They had to abandon it because they couldn't get rid of it's sexist bias - having an all girl college on your CV for example gave you a lower score. This was 'learnt' from Amazons own behaviour.

The US justice system tried to use AI to get rid of bias in sentencing, again, what it learnt from was historical sentence data with the result it ended up with a significant racial bias and had to be abandoned.

AI learns from the data that is input, much as human babies do. Given that much of the data humans have produced is sexist and racist, it isn't surprising that AI is too - or that humans are without even realising it.
